The Silver Marketing Association Summit
Headline Sponsor
When: Tuesday 27th June 2023
Where: The Cavendish Centre, London W12
The Silver Marketing Summit is Europe’s leading conference focused on the “silver” market – offering marketers the opportunity to enjoy a full day of expert speakers and networking sessions. Plus a free copy of the “50 Shades of Silver” market segmentation report.

The Health Challenge
There are increasing levels of ill-health in the older population. UK citizens spend 20% of their life in poor health on average and there is a 20 year difference in healthy life expectancy between the richest and the poorest. How can the nation age more healthily in the future, and what is the role that marketing can play in communicating key messages?
Tina Woods – Founder & CEO, Collider Health and Business for Health

16.05 The Workplace in your 50s, 60s and beyond – how to market to older workers?
It’s a hot topic with over 300,000 more people aged 50+ deemed economically inactive since before the pandemic. Are they really all on the golf course? How are companies marketing to recruit & retain an older workforce? Panel discussion & audience Q&A.
